Who We Are: 

In 1922, Woodcraft Rangers opened its doors in Los Angeles and began its mission of guiding young people as they explore pathways to purposeful lives. As a progressive organization, Woodcraft has always been responsive to the evolving needs of the communities served, and is notably inclusive, youth-led, and rooted in the Woodcraft Way, a holistic framework that develops body, mind, spirit, and service. Continuously at the forefront of expanded learning opportunities, Woodcraft Rangers has a rich history of making a significant impact in the greater Los Angeles area, believing that all youth are innately good, deserve the opportunity to realize their full potential, and should be an active participant in defining their own path. 

What We Do: 

Woodcraft Rangers provides TK-12 expanded learning programs, including before and after school, specialty enrichment, and summer learning. In the past few years, Woodcraft has expanded its menu of services beyond traditional afterschool programs and summer camps to include early learning, environmental and social justice, college access, and inclusion services for youth with intellectual and developmental disabilities. Additionally, we offer LifeCraft, a college and career advancement program to support the development of approximately 2,000 staff. Today, Woodcraft Rangers serves more than 30,000 youth ages 4 to 18 each year across 150 plus Title I schools in Los Angeles, San Bernardino, and Riverside counties, and continues to expand its reach.

Role Overview: 

We are seeking a motivated and detail-focused Accounts Payable Accountant to join the Finance & Accounting team at Woodcraft Rangers. This role is responsible for the accurate and timely processing of vendor invoices, expense reimbursements, and disbursements in support of the organization’s mission. 

The AP Accountant works closely with the Senior AP Accountant and operates within the organization’s AP systems and policies to ensure every outgoing payment is properly documented, coded, and approved. This is a great opportunity for an accounting professional looking to grow their skills in a mission-driven nonprofit environment. 
 

Responsibilities: 

Invoice Processing & Payment Support 

  • Receive, review, and process vendor invoices, ensuring proper documentation, authorization, and approval prior to payment 

  • Code invoices accurately to the appropriate cost center, program, grant, or fund per the organization’s chart of accounts 

  • Enter and submit invoices through Bill.com in accordance with established workflows and approval routing 

  • Monitor the AP inbox and Bill.com queue to ensure invoices are received and processed in a timely manner 

  • Prepare and process check runs, ACH payments, and other disbursements as directed 

  • Match purchase orders, receiving documents, and invoices (three-way match) where applicable 

Vendor & Record Management 

  • Maintain accurate and up-to-date vendor records, including W-9s, contact information, and payment preferences 

  • Communicate with vendors to resolve invoice discrepancies, missing documentation, or payment inquiries in a timely and professional manner 

  • Assist with year-end 1099 preparation by ensuring vendor tax information is complete and accurate 

  • File and organize AP documentation in accordance with the department’s recordkeeping standards 

Expense Reimbursements & Policy Compliance 

  • Process employee expense reimbursement requests, verifying receipts, proper coding, and policy compliance prior to submission for approval 

  • Flag missing documentation, policy exceptions, or unapproved expenses to the Senior AP Accountant for review 

  • Apply organizational spending policies consistently across all reimbursement requests 

  • Support corporate credit card reconciliation processes by following up with cardholders on outstanding receipts and coding questions 

Month-End & Close Support 

  • Support month-end close activities including AP aging review, accrual preparation, and vendor statement reconciliations 

  • Ensure all invoices for the period are entered and approved by established close deadlines 

  • Assist with reconciliation of the AP subledger to the general ledger 

  • Respond promptly to requests from the Senior AP Accountant or Controller during close and audit periods
